Kingpin is a fictional character appearing in American comic books published by Marvel Comics. He is typically depicted as an amoral crime lord. The character was created by writer Stan Lee and artist John Romita Sr., and first appeared in The Amazing Spider-Man #50 (cover-dated July 1967). Since his creation, the Kingpin has appeared in numerous comic books and graphic novels, usually as a recurring adversary of Spider-Man. He has also been featured in various forms of media, including animated television series, video games, and live-action films.

A double wishbone suspension is an independent suspension design using two (occasionally parallel) wishbone -shaped arms to locate the wheel. Each wishbone or arm has two mounting points to the chassis and one joint at the knuckle. The shock absorber and coil spring mount to the wishbones to control vertical movement.
